Leg 1 – Real Madrid to beat Villarreal @ 9/10 [Saturday 5:30pm]

Real Madrid travel to Villarreal in La Liga with Carlo Ancelotti's side battling with Barcelona and Atletico Madrid for the title.

Real are second behind Barcelona on goal difference, while Atletico are just one point behind their rivals.

Los Blancos, who are unbeaten in 13 of their last 15 matches against Villarreal, can go top of the league and put huge pressure on their rivals ahead of Barcelona's trip to Atletico on Sunday.

Ancelotti's men are unbeaten in four of their last five in the league and we can’t look past them. Although Villarreal have a decent home record (won five, drawn five, lost two), Real have too much strength in depth.

Leg 2 – Fulham double chance vs Tottenham and over 2.5 goals @ 1/1 [Sunday 1:30pm]

One Premier League game is taking our fancy as Fulham host Tottenham.

Spurs playing in the Europa League on Thursday could play into Fulham's hands and there’s value in backing Fulham double chance and over 2.5 goals.

Tottenham are 13th in the Premier League while Fulham have won three of their last five to leave them in 10th.

Fulham have won five of their last seven in all competitions and Spurs have won just five of their 13 league matches on the road.

Adding in over 2.5 goals makes sense as Tottenham's games are averaging 3.4 goals. We’ve also seen three or more goals in four of Fulham's last five matches.

Leg 3 – Over 2.5 goals in Atalanta vs Inter Milan @ 3/4 [Sunday 7:45pm]

First travel to third in Serie A as Inter Milan visit Atalanta.

Inter are top of the table and one point ahead of Napoli, with Atalanta a further two points back.

Atalanta just hammered Juventus 4-0 in their last outing, while Inter are unbeaten in four of their last five games.

Instead of picking a winner, we like over 2.5 goals.

There have been 14 goals in Atalanta's last five league games and Inter's matches are averaging 3.2 goals this season.

Leg 4 – Over 2.5 goals in Atletico Madrid vs Barcelona @ 1/2 [Sunday 8pm]

We've mentioned the landscape at the summit of La Liga and we get to enjoy Atletico and Barcelona facing off on Sunday night. 

Atletico suffered a surprise defeat against Getafe last time out but they're still just one point behind Barcelona and they're also unbeaten at home (won 10, drawn four). 

Barcelona are in sensational form and Hansi Flick's side have won their last six La Liga games while also boasting the best away form in the division.

We should be in for a cracker and we like over 2.5 goals.

Barcelona's games average a league-high 3.7 goals and they've scored 38 times in their 14 outings on the road. The selection has also landed in three of Atletico's last five.
